Tour Overview

Amritsar was founded in 1577 by Ram Das, fourth Guru of the Sikhs, on a site granted by the Mughal emperor Akbar. Ram Das ordered the excavation of the sacred tank, or pool, called the Amrita Saras (“Pool of Nectar”), from which the city’s name is derived. A temple was erected on an island in the tank’s centre by Arjan, the fifth Guru of the Sikhs, which was then reached by a marble causeway. During the reign of Maharaja Ranjit Singh (1801–39), the upper part of the temple was decorated with a gold-foil-covered copper dome, and since then the building has been popularly known as the Golden Temple. Amritsar became the centre of the Sikh faith, and, as the focus of growing Sikh power, the city experienced a corresponding increase in trade. It was annexed to British India in 1849.

Day 2: Amritsar Sightseeing

Today Post Breakfast We Go On Full Day Guided Tour Of Amritsar We Visit, “Golden Temple”, It Is The Most Sacred Temple Of The Sikhs Built By Maharaja Ranjit Singh. The Lower Portion Of The Temple Displays White Marble Inlay Work And The Upper Portion Is Embellished With Copper Coated Over By Gold Plate. Later We Visit “Jallian Wala Memorial”, It Is Memory Of Martyrs-13 April; 1919" Has Been Inscribed In Hindi, Punjabi, Urdu And English. Post Lunch We Visit “Durgiana Temple” Situated Outside The Hathi Gate Durgiana Mandir Is Largest Hindu Temple In The City. This Temple Is Devoted To Goddess Durga And Dates Back To 16th Century. Afternoon Approx 14:00 Hrs Drive To Bagha Border Approx 10 Kms. “Wagha Border” One Of The Most Attractive Destination Of Amritsar, People Visit This Place In Large Numbers To Witness The Lowering Down Of The Flags Of Both Countries. The Only Post, Where A Special Parade Is Organized To Lower The Flags Simultaneously From The Flag Poles In The Evening, Beams With Activity. The Flag Lowering Ceremony, Better Known As The 'Retreat' Is Performed Every day, Shortly Before Sunset, By Border Security Force (BSF) Jawans On The Indian Side And Pakistan Rangers On The Other Side.
